1. A pressure and temperature sensor comprising:

  • a substantially hermetically sealed insulating package;

    an elastic, piezoelectric substrate deformably supported within the package along two lines substantially perpendicular to a long axis of the substrate; and

    at least three surface-acoustic-wave resonators affixed to a bottom of the substrate, the three resonators comprising;

    a first and a second resonator, each having a long propagation axis parallel therebetween, positioned in at least partially staggered relation along the substrate for experiencing different deformations under strain, and each having a substantially equivalent temperature coefficient; and

    a third resonator having a long propagation axis nonparallel to the long axes of the first and the second resonator and a temperature coefficient different from the temperature coefficient of the first and the second resonators.
